What two characteristics made Monroe doctrine important to us foreign policy

There were two characteristics that made the Monroe Doctrine important to the US foreign policy. One was that it helped colonies in North and South America to adopt a more democratic government. The other was that it viewed European interference in the America's as a threat to the US national interests.
